This patch adds USB3 support to the printer driver.
Tests used two binaries (host/device) to handle the file transfer

^ permalink raw reply [flat|nested] 3+ messages in thread* [PATCH] usb: gadget: add USB3 support to the printer driver 2014-11-18 20:11 [PATCH] usb: gadget: add USB3 support to the printer driver Jorge Ramirez-Ortiz @ 2014-11-18 20:11 ` Jorge Ramirez-Ortiz 2014-11-20 19:42 ` Felipe Balbi 0 siblings, 1 reply; 3+ messages in thread From: Jorge Ramirez-Ortiz @ 2014-11-18 20:11 UTC (permalink / raw) To: jorge.ramirez-ortiz, balbi, gregkh, linux-usb, linux-kernel Add SS descriptors to support the capabilities provided by USB3 controller drivers; unit tests run using a PLX 3380 [max transfer speed measured of 1Gbps] This driver shall fallback to lower operating modes when the higher ones are not available. Signed-off-by: Jorge Ramirez-Ortiz <jorge.ramirez-ortiz@linaro.org> --- drivers/usb/gadget/legacy/printer.c | 65 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++---- 1 file changed, 59 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-) diff --git a/drivers/usb/gadget/legacy/printer.c b/drivers/usb/gadget/legacy/printer.c index 6474081..456730b 100644 --- a/drivers/usb/gadget/legacy/printer.c +++ b/drivers/usb/gadget/legacy/printer.c @@ -208,6 +208,43 @@ static struct usb_descriptor_header *hs_printer_function[] = { NULL }; +/* + * Added endpoint descriptors for 3.0 devices + */ + +static struct usb_endpoint_descriptor ss_ep_in_desc = { + .bLength = USB_DT_ENDPOINT_SIZE, + .bDescriptorType = USB_DT_ENDPOINT, + .bmAttributes = USB_ENDPOINT_XFER_BULK, + .wMaxPacketSize = cpu_to_le16(1024), +}; + +struct usb_ss_ep_comp_descriptor ss_ep_in_comp_desc = { + .bLength = sizeof(ss_ep_in_comp_desc), + .bDescriptorType = USB_DT_SS_ENDPOINT_COMP, +}; + +static struct usb_endpoint_descriptor ss_ep_out_desc = { + .bLength = USB_DT_ENDPOINT_SIZE, + .bDescriptorType = USB_DT_ENDPOINT, + .bmAttributes = USB_ENDPOINT_XFER_BULK, + .wMaxPacketSize = cpu_to_le16(1024), +}; + +struct usb_ss_ep_comp_descriptor ss_ep_out_comp_desc = { + .bLength = sizeof(ss_ep_out_comp_desc), + .bDescriptorType = USB_DT_SS_ENDPOINT_COMP, +}; + +static struct usb_descriptor_header *ss_printer_function[] = { + (struct usb_descriptor_header *) &intf_desc, + (struct usb_descriptor_header *) &ss_ep_in_desc, + (struct usb_descriptor_header *) &ss_ep_in_comp_desc, + (struct usb_descriptor_header *) &ss_ep_out_desc, + (struct usb_descriptor_header *) &ss_ep_out_comp_desc, + NULL +}; + static struct usb_otg_descriptor otg_descriptor = { .bLength = sizeof otg_descriptor, .bDescriptorType = USB_DT_OTG, @@ -220,7 +257,20 @@ static const struct usb_descriptor_header *otg_desc[] = { }; /* maxpacket and other transfer characteristics vary by speed. */ -#define ep_desc(g, hs, fs) (((g)->speed == USB_SPEED_HIGH)?(hs):(fs)) +static inline struct usb_endpoint_descriptor *ep_desc(struct usb_gadget *gadget, + struct usb_endpoint_descriptor *fs, + struct usb_endpoint_descriptor *hs, + struct usb_endpoint_descriptor *ss) +{ + switch(gadget->speed) { + case USB_SPEED_SUPER: + return ss; + case USB_SPEED_HIGH: + return hs; + default: + return fs; + } +} /*-------------------------------------------------------------------------*/ @@ -793,11 +843,12 @@ set_printer_interface(struct printer_dev *dev) { int result = 0; - dev->in_ep->desc = ep_desc(dev->gadget, &hs_ep_in_desc, &fs_ep_in_desc); + dev->in_ep->desc = ep_desc(dev->gadget, &fs_ep_in_desc, &hs_ep_in_desc, + &ss_ep_in_desc); dev->in_ep->driver_data = dev; - dev->out_ep->desc = ep_desc(dev->gadget, &hs_ep_out_desc, - &fs_ep_out_desc); + dev->out_ep->desc = ep_desc(dev->gadget, &fs_ep_out_desc, + &hs_ep_out_desc, &ss_ep_out_desc); dev->out_ep->driver_data = dev; result = usb_ep_enable(dev->in_ep); @@ -1016,9 +1067,11 @@ autoconf_fail: /* assumes that all endpoints are dual-speed */ hs_ep_in_desc.bEndpointAddress = fs_ep_in_desc.bEndpointAddress; hs_ep_out_desc.bEndpointAddress = fs_ep_out_desc.bEndpointAddress; + ss_ep_in_desc.bEndpointAddress = fs_ep_in_desc.bEndpointAddress; + ss_ep_out_desc.bEndpointAddress = fs_ep_out_desc.bEndpointAddress; ret = usb_assign_descriptors(f, fs_printer_function, - hs_printer_function, NULL); + hs_printer_function, ss_printer_function); if (ret) return ret; @@ -1253,7 +1306,7 @@ static __refdata struct usb_composite_driver printer_driver = { .name = shortname, .dev = &device_desc, .strings = dev_strings, - .max_speed = USB_SPEED_HIGH, + .max_speed = USB_SPEED_SUPER, .bind = printer_bind, .unbind = printer_unbind, }; -- 1.9.1 ^ permalink raw reply related [flat|nested] 3+ messages in thread
